The Connection Between Weight Loss and Hair Health

Understanding the Relationship

When you lose weight, your body undergoes various changes that can impact your hair health. Nutritional deficiencies, hormonal fluctuations, and lifestyle adjustments can all play a role. It’s essential to focus on a balanced approach that nourishes both your body and your hair.

10 Simple Changes for Weight Loss and Hair Health

1. Embrace a Balanced Diet

Nutrient-Dense Foods

Focus on a diet rich in fruits, vegetables, lean proteins, whole grains, and healthy fats. These foods provide essential vitamins and minerals that support both weight loss and hair health.

  • Key Nutrients:
    • Biotin: Found in eggs and nuts; promotes hair growth.
    • Iron: Found in leafy greens and red meat; essential for oxygen delivery to hair follicles.

2. Stay Hydrated

The Importance of Water

Drinking enough water is crucial for overall health, including hair vitality and metabolism. Aim for at least 8 cups of water a day to keep your body and hair hydrated.

3. Limit Processed Foods

Reducing Empty Calories

Processed foods often contain unhealthy fats and added sugars that can hinder weight loss and negatively affect hair health. Opt for whole, minimally processed foods whenever possible.

4. Incorporate Regular Exercise

Benefits for Body and Hair

Engaging in regular physical activity not only helps with weight loss but also promotes blood circulation, which is vital for healthy hair growth. Aim for at least 150 minutes of moderate exercise each week.

  • Recommended Activities:
    • Walking, jogging, cycling, or strength training.

5. Get Sufficient Sleep

The Role of Sleep in Health

Quality sleep is essential for weight management and hair health. Lack of sleep can lead to stress and hormonal imbalances, both of which can impact your hair. Aim for 7-9 hours of restful sleep each night.

6. Manage Stress Effectively

Stress and Its Impact

High stress can lead to emotional eating and hair loss. Implement stress-reduction techniques such as mindfulness, yoga, or deep-breathing exercises to maintain balance.

7. Use Gentle Hair Care Products

Protecting Your Strands

Choose shampoos and conditioners free from sulfates and parabens to minimize damage. Look for products that nourish your hair while being kind to your scalp.

8. Avoid Fad Diets

Sustainable Weight Loss

Extreme dieting can lead to nutritional deficiencies, which negatively affect hair health. Instead, focus on gradual weight loss through balanced eating and exercise.

9. Consider Hair Supplements

Supporting Hair Health

If you’re struggling to get enough nutrients from your diet, consider supplements that support hair growth, such as biotin, collagen, or omega-3 fatty acids. Consult a healthcare professional before starting any new supplements.

10. Track Your Progress

Monitoring for Success

Keep a journal or use apps to track your food intake, exercise, and hair health. This can help you identify patterns and make adjustments as needed, supporting both your weight loss and hair care goals.
